What is Ancestry Day?

Ancestry Day is a significant event in Haiti, recognizing the contributions and heritage of Haitians' ancestors.

The holiday focuses on celebrating Haitian culture and tradition.

It acknowledges the importance of honoring one's ancestors.

In Haiti, [the holiday is observed as] a public holiday, allowing people to dedicate time to their ancestors and culture.

How to observe

In Haiti, people typically observe Ancestry Day by hosting cultural events and family gatherings.

They take the opportunity to honor and thank their ancestors for their contributions.

Family reunions and celebrations are common, acknowledging the importance of their heritage.
